Output 35d12076cb5ef21f6b1c34db64b1b75624a4566a061a07a47b7fe5b57ad8ec86:0

value
1864900
script pubkey
OP_0 OP_PUSHBYTES_20 8835f13d0ca2c3058cfe53543e203fc780200897
address
bc1q3q6lz0gv5tpstr872d2rugplc7qzqzyh7sdhfy
transaction
35d12076cb5ef21f6b1c34db64b1b75624a4566a061a07a47b7fe5b57ad8ec86
spent
true